Marie-Thérèse Armentero is a Swiss swimmer born on November 13, 1965. She won a bronze medal in the 50 m freestyle at the 1986 World Aquatics Championships and competed in the 1984 and 1988 Summer Olympics. Armentero set a Canadian Interuniversity Sport record in the 50 m freestyle, which lasted for 18 years, while at the University of Toronto. She also received the CIS Female Swimmer of the Year award in 1988 and later set a European record in the masters category. She was inducted into the University of Toronto Sports Hall of Fame in 2006.
